    Nevada County is looking for a Chief Fiscal Administrative Officer (CFAO) to oversee administrative and fiscal functions of the Community Development Agency (CDA).

     

    Under general direction, the CFAO for CDA plans, organizes and supervises the work of staff involved in the financial, administrative, or other special functions which support a large department or agency, and performs related work as required.

     

    This is a classification with responsibility for the administrative and support services functions. This class is distinguished from the next higher level of Director which has overall executive responsibility for the functions of the department or Agency.

    Duties Include:

    The CFAO supervises the duties of fiscal and administrative personnel and coordinates all fiscal and administrative operations within the Agency. The CFAO is a key position in CDA whose mission is to provide outstanding customer service through sound and innovative policies and strong leadership. CDA works to enhance the quality of life of county residents through land use planning and permitting, environmental management; to provide public services including agriculture, code and cannabis compliance, road and infrastructure maintenance and improvements, transit, solid waste, and wastewater; to deliver internal services including fleet services, administrative and fiscal; and to promote and support recreation, climate and economic development throughout the community. We do this through accountability, collaboration, compassion, integrity and dedication to service.

    Primary duties of the CFAO include:

    + Coordinating with Department Heads and staff, and representing the Agency with the Board of Supervisors, the public, community partners, and other government agencies, as needed.

    + Providing internal consultation and analysis on financial, fiscal, human resources, contract/grant management, and intergovernmental relations issues to the Agency.

    + Developing and supervising the submission of the annual budget and fee ordinance for CDA.

    + Reviewing and analyzing regulatory and case law impacts.

    + Providing and overseeing administrative services.

    + Drafting, negotiating, and monitoring contracts and grants.

    + Ensuring compliance with state and federal laws.

    Knowledge Required

    + Principles and practices of public administration including work planning, assignment and review; personnel practices, policies and procedures; budget development and administration; and governmental purchasing practices

    + Accounting principles and practices, preparing sophisticated and detailed written and verbal reports, financial forecasting, and budget submissions

    + Government accounting and budgetary recordkeeping

    + Pertinent federal, state and county laws, rules, and regulations pertaining to accountability of funds

    + Standard office management information systems

    Education and Experience Required

     

    A bachelor's degree from an accredited college or university in economics, public or business administration, accounting, or a related field. Three years of responsible experience in fiscal and administrative management at a level comparable to an Administrative Services Officer with the County of Nevada.

    OR

    A bachelor's degree from an accredited college or university and 10 years of responsible experience in fiscal and administrative management at a level comparable to Administrative Services Officer with the County of Nevada.

    Retirement

     

    The County is a member of the CalPERS retirement system and also provides the opportunity for voluntary contributions to a 457 deferred compensation account through Nationwide by way of pre-tax and Roth payroll deductions.

     

    CalPERS Miscellaneous Tiers: Tier 1 (Classic-former employee originally hired on or before 12/13/12 and are returning to Nevada County) 2.7% @ 55 Tier 2 (Hired by a CalPERS employer between 12/14/12-12/31/12 and coming to Nevada County with less than 6 months between separation from former CalPERS employer and hire date with Nevada County) 2%@60 Tier 3 (Hired by first CalPERS employer on or after 1/1/13 or having a break in service of more than six months between another CalPERS employer and Nevada County) 2%@62

     

    CalPERS Safety tiers: Tier 1 (Classic-former employees originally hired on or before 12/13/12 and are returning to Nevada County) 3% @ 50. Tier 2 (Hired by a CalPERS employer between 7/2411-12/31/12 and coming to Nevada County with less than 6-months between separation from former CalPERS employer and hire date with Nevada County) 3% @ 55. Tier 3 (Hired by any CalPERS employer on or after 1/1/13) 2.7% @ 57.
